Output a63cf4ae7628efc7ed99cb7815b78caabf762da4357f7bd48e6a78acdbb337ee:0

value
16134811
script pubkey
OP_0 OP_PUSHBYTES_20 dfdd70d1a60023b56903ca41fdf64d0b4b58d58d
address
bc1qmlwhp5dxqq3m26grefqlmajdpd9434vd45vmck
transaction
a63cf4ae7628efc7ed99cb7815b78caabf762da4357f7bd48e6a78acdbb337ee
confirmations
48443
spent
true